Lixiang Education receives noncompliance notification from Nasdaq
Compliance Issue: Lixiang Education has received a notice from Nasdaq regarding non-compliance with Listing Rule 5450, which mandates a minimum market value of publicly held shares of $5 million for continued listing.
Potential Consequences: The company's failure to meet this requirement could jeopardize its listing status on the Nasdaq Global Market.

Warning of Pump-and-Dump Schemes: Edwin Dorsey, author of "The Bear Cave," has highlighted a surge in pump-and-dump stock schemes targeting thinly traded China-based stocks, with specific stocks like QMMM and Cuprina Holdings experiencing extreme price volatility.
Evidence of Manipulation: Stocks mentioned in Dorsey's report have shown significant price increases without substantial news, indicating potential manipulation, prompting Dorsey to launch a website to gather evidence against the scammers.

Investment Scam Overview: Braden Lindstrom, a college professor, was scammed out of $80,000 by an impersonator posing as a financial adviser, leading him to invest in Jayud Global Logistics, a small Chinese company whose stock price dramatically crashed after initially rising.
Market Manipulation Concerns: Wall Street experts highlight that this type of scam is common with small Chinese stocks, which are often susceptible to manipulation and easily accessible to U.S. investors.
